Rear Hatch Unlock

Hi,

when pulling into parking garages they want to open the rear hatch and inspect the cargo area.

I'm finding that I have to open the front door (after unlocking the doors) for the attendant to open the rear hatch. Unlocking the doors alone without physically opening the front drivers door will not allow the attendant to open the rear hatch. Any ideas?

so, I RTFM and was reminded that there is a Tail Gate Option under the comfort settings/doors. The manual also indicated that the Tail Gate Option must be selected for it to work with the central locking system and it's been so long since I've been in this part of the menu scheme that I thought maybe it wasn't selected - but it was.

Also tried using the remote control and still the tail gate didn't option. Guess I'll tap my CPO coverage and see what the dealer has to say. Thanks for the feedback.

End of the story - dealer said he reprogrammed my remote. I can now pull up to a garage, not put in park or open the front door, simply press the unlock button on the armrest (twice) and the tailgate is unlocked allowing for inspection in the cargo area.
